Output 824704d496378b7576bb3b4d6ec4e1f2b8c14d20da636d90d0c7443282db05eb:1

value
41733591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77458564edce675e693e46696463ec3fbc72676c OP_EQUAL
address
3CZfcnD9j7c5cRzdfUpbKo2SZ8xFPGz6dB
transaction
824704d496378b7576bb3b4d6ec4e1f2b8c14d20da636d90d0c7443282db05eb
spent
true